Output 724884657595ebf226dfd4f25919e0067c6d70b5f734a40dcc26acf1f066a706:74

value
280818762
script pubkey
OP_0 OP_PUSHBYTES_20 bf7c28c7791bf4598b6eb949bd171de0ae6f62ec
address
bc1qha7z33mer069nzmwh9ym69cauzhx7chv7c8p37
transaction
724884657595ebf226dfd4f25919e0067c6d70b5f734a40dcc26acf1f066a706